1996 IT Society Paper Award

The 1996 Information Theory Society Paper Award has been awarded to Frans Willems, Yuri Shtarkov and Tjalling Tjalkens for their paper entitled ``The Context-Tree Weighting Method: Basic Properties'' published in the IEEE Transactions on Information Theory, Volume IT-41, No. 3, May 1995.

The Information Theory Society Paper Award, consisting of a certificate and honorarium, is given annually for an outstanding publication in the field of information theory published anywhere during the preceding two-year period. Its purpose is to recognize exceptional publcations in the field and to stimulate interest in, and encourage contributions to, the discipline.
